COMPANY OVERVIEW
Imagenet is a leading provider of back-office support technology and tech-enabled outsourced services to healthcare plans nationwide. Imagenet provides claims processing services, including digital transformation, claims adjudication and member and provider engagement services, acting as a mission-critical partner to these plans in enhancing engagement and satisfaction with plans’ members and providers.
The company currently serves over 70 health plans, acting as a mission-critical partner to these plans in enhancing overall care, engagement and satisfaction with plans’ members and providers.The company processes millions of claims and multiples of related structured and unstructured data elements within these claims annually. The
company has also developed an innovative workflow technology platform, JetStreamTM, to help with traceability, governance and automation of claims operations for its clients.
Imagenet is headquartered in Tampa, operates 10 regional offices throughout the U.S. and has a wholly owned global delivery center in the Philippines.
